Comments

Bogies Y23. The reproduction is as fine as for the ANF tank wagons. The metal steps seem to be fixed more firmly than on the latter, but they are twisted and can not be easily straightened.

History

Small series of 13 m long, 70 m3 capacity tank wagons, with heat insulation envelope, built in the sixties by Fauvet-Girel.

Designed for the transport of black petroleum products (heavy fuel oil), they were originally equipped with a steam heater (intercooler) which can be seen from the “scar” on the model.

Note: the tank wagons received the series letter Z after the modification of the UIC numbering in 1980. But, previously, they entered in the “catch-all” series U. To distinguish under this letter of the very varied types (liquid or gas tanks, cereals hoppers, cement silos, etc.), a subscript letter was used, namely h for tanks, which gave Uh for a 2-axle tank and Uah for a bogie tank.
